Gradus provide their Wall Protection products for the £350m Grange University Hospital
Gradus Wall Protection products have been fitted throughout the £350m Grange University Hospital, the first major hospital to be built in Wales in more than two decades. The state-of-the-art facility has 2,612 rooms and more than 40 specialist services.

Non-fragile roofing for Pembroke Dock Station
Twinfix worked with Principal Contractor AmcoGiffen restoring Pembroke Dock Station with its non-fragile roofing system.

Kemper System help refurbish manor roof
The roof of Stansted House, a Grade II Listed Edwardian house was refurbished using a liquid waterproofing solution from Kemper System.

Introducing RonaScreed FastDry Prompt
RonaScreed FastDry Prompt is a fast-drying additive for site batched screeds used to reduce the level of retained moisture within the
screed.
